Thank you tali.kah, I’m glad to hear someone testing with fmu, I was advised to not use flu to test ovulation but Fmu suits me to do before I head to work. I guess a wee test morning afternoon and evening wouldn’t hurt ��

It depends on the brand you use. Some are calibrated for FMU. Others are going to give you better results being used after lunch because that is when the hormone in the urine peaks. So testing at the wrong time of day may mean that window of opportunity for your attempt is 12-24 hours narrower than it has to be - let's say you test Monday am and it's negative, then you surge Monday afternoon but you don't test then. Takes you all the way till Tues. to detect that surge!
